Technical Standards and Specifications
A core component of the Fastenal Technical Reference Guide involves understanding the
various standards that govern fastener and industrial component specifications. This
ensures compatibility, safety, and performance.
Industry Standards and Certifications
Fastenal products are manufactured and tested according to recognized standards such
as:
ANSI (American National Standards Institute): Provides specifications for
mechanical fasteners, including thread forms and dimensions.
ASME (American Society of Mechanical Engineers): Sets standards for
pressure vessel fasteners and related components.
ASTM (American Society for Testing and Materials): Defines material
properties and testing procedures for fasteners.
ISO (International Organization for Standardization): International standards
for fastener dimensions, tolerances, and performance.
The guide offers detailed references to these standards, aiding users in selecting products
that meet their specific technical and safety requirements.
Material and Finish Specifications
Choosing the right fastener involves understanding material properties and finishes:
Materials: Steel (carbon, alloy, stainless), aluminum, brass, and other corrosion-
resistant alloys.
Finishes: Zinc plating, hot-dip galvanizing, black oxide, chromate conversion, and
more.
Each material and finish combination offers different levels of strength, corrosion
resistance, and suitability for environmental conditions. The reference guide provides
detailed charts and tables to facilitate optimal selection. ---

Understanding Mechanical Properties
Fasteners are rated based on:
Tensile Strength: The maximum stress the fastener can withstand while being
pulled.
Yield Strength: The stress at which the fastener begins to deform permanently.
Hardness: Resistance to deformation or wear.
Selecting fasteners with appropriate mechanical properties ensures they meet the
demands of the application.
Thread Types and Sizes
The guide includes detailed charts on:
Thread Forms: Unified National (UNC/UNF), Metric, Acme, Trapezoidal.
Thread Pitch and Diameter: Guidelines for selecting the correct thread size for
load and fit requirements.
Thread Engagement: Recommendations for minimum thread engagement to
ensure strength.
Matching the thread type and size to the application prevents failures such as stripping or
loosening.
Environmental and Load Considerations
Fastener choice must account for:
Corrosion Resistance: Use stainless steel or coated fasteners in harsh
environments.
Vibration and Dynamic Loads: Locking mechanisms, thread-locking compounds,
and lock nuts can mitigate loosening.
Temperature Extremes: Select materials with suitable thermal properties.
The guide provides application-specific recommendations to optimize performance and
durability. ---

Installation Best Practices
Key points include:
Correct Tools: Use the appropriate sizes and types of wrenches, drivers, or torque
tools.
Torque Specifications: Follow manufacturer guidelines and standards to prevent
over-tightening or under-tightening.
Lubrication: Use lubricants or anti-seize compounds where recommended to
reduce galling and facilitate proper torque.
Adhering to these practices ensures optimal fastener performance and reduces risk of
failure.
Maintenance and Inspection
Regular checks help maintain safety and integrity:
Visual Inspections: Look for signs of corrosion, wear, or loosening.
Torque Checks: Re-tighten fasteners according to schedule or application needs.
Replacement: Replace damaged or compromised fasteners promptly.
The guide provides inspection checklists and maintenance schedules to streamline these
processes.
